DECISION & ORDER ON MOTION

Motion by the appellant, inter alia, to prosecute an appeal from an order of the Supreme Court, Westchester County (IDV Part), dated January 29, 2020, as a poor person, and for the assignment of counsel.

Upon the papers filed in support of the motion and the papers filed in opposition thereto, it is

ORDERED that the branch of the motion which is to prosecute the appeal on the original papers is denied as unnecessary (see Family Ct Act § 1116), and the appeal will be heard on the original papers (including a certified transcript of the proceedings, if any) and on the briefs of the appellant, the respondent, and the attorney for the children, if any. The parties are directed to file an original and five duplicate hard copies, and, if represented by counsel, one digital copy, of their respective briefs, and to serve one hard copy on each other (22 NYCRR 1250.5[e][1], 1250.9[a][4],[c][1],[d],[e]; Family Ct Act § 1116); and it is further,

ORDERED that the motion is otherwise denied.
